  9. carguyinok posted a post in a topic in Body & Paint
    First on the rear 1\4 glass. There are four screws two on top two lower. If you have rust these are not going to be fun. I would say grind or drill the heads off the screws. Pull the glass out then deal with that rust. The glass will come out easy frame and all as one. I will put A photo in for you. Front 1\4's PULL THEM. here. http://www.240z.org/forums/showthread.php?s=&threadid=3077 Read this it will help. Black. Please think about what you want. The darker the color the more flaws in the body pop out. You will also want A carwash at your house. Black shows dirt and dust more then any other color. But A Z in black would look good.

  16. carguyinok posted a post in a topic in Hybrid & Aftermarket
    I have been collecting information for about 1 year now and can get most info first hand. My father and uncle were the original engine builders for Brian Scarab in the 1970's. There respective shops were back to back in Campbell, CA. Basic progression started out with Chevy 350 Crate motors, with a Warner T-10 Tranny, custom Drive line and Radiator connected to a T-Bird rear end. Some minor Suspension mods and custom motor mounts were fabricated as well. Later versions of the engine were more performance oriented and included up to a Twin Turbo 280z clocked at well over 170 mph in So. CA. The Scarab car was either custom built (the owner supplied the car to Brian for Mods) or a kit could be purchased for self-modification. Hope this helps. Good luck. -Andy Tencati

  21. carguyinok posted a post in a topic in Body & Paint
    I wish I had done this long ago. I had always thought of pulling my front fenders. I just never did this due to the fear of how hard it may be. I was wrong. Each fender took me about 15 minn. each. Wow am I A happy camper.:classic: . I do have A 90% rust free Z. I would say to anyone going deep into there Z PULL THEM. I found alot of sand and road grime in there that would have started some real rut problems. Most of this was stuck up near the frame work in the lower part of the front 1\4s just in front of the door. I did find the little surface rust dots here and there but nothing that I would worry about. I do plan on scuffing off the rust dots (size if pin heads yes surface not from the inside) and running A solid weld up the frame work. Then coat it.
